#1fe447 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fe447 is composed of 12.2% red, 89.4%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.9%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 132.2 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 50.8%. #1fe447 color hex could be obtained by blending #3eff8e with #00c900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#1fe447 color description : Vivid lime green.
#1fe447 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fe447 has RGB values of R:31, G:228,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 2090055.

Shades and Tints of #1fe447
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1fe447
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808380 is the less saturated color, while #0cf73c is the most saturated one.
